It has been sorted out what caused this problem. Thanks to Seth M.
LaForge <sethml@burn.ofb.net> for his investigation...

Seth writes:
Aha, rooting around in the ReiserFS source, I found the problem.  The           
ReiserFS rusapov hash only pays attention to the last log10(2^32) ~=            
10 characters in the filename.  The xfonts-75dpi package contains 185           
files that end in "-1.pcf.gz".  With ".dpkg-tmp" appended, all of               
those filenames hash to the same value.  ReiserFS can deal with up to           
127 files with the same hash in the same directory.  dpkg doesn't               
delete the ".dpkg-tmp" files until it has unpacked everything, so when          
it gets 127 files into the installation, kaboom.

For more information & possible solutions, see bug #107843 in the BTS.
